The Lyons Den Radio Show

🎙️ The Lyons Den Radio Show with DJ George LyonsLive from Las Vegas on KUNV 91.5 FM, every Sunday 4–8 PM PST. Since 1998, it’s been blending all genres into one technorganic groove—live sets, rare gems, and sonic surprises.📡 Stream free at kunv.org/listen💥 Musical Schizophrenia. Music is the Healing Force.🔊 Turn it on & turn it up!

    Lyons Den: Grateful Dead Live 1984, Tom Petty, AC/DC, Amy Winehouse & Musical Schizophrenia

    This week on The Lyons Den Radio Show, George Lyons celebrates the art of musical discovery with a freeform radio experience unlike anything else on the dial. From classic rock and soul to alternative favorites and deep album cuts, George explores the "A's" of the KUNV music library before settling into a legendary live performance from the Grateful Dead, recorded October 12, 1984, at the Augusta Civic Center in Maine.Along the way you'll hear music from Tom Petty & The Heartbreakers, AC/DC, Alice Cooper, Amy Winehouse, Aretha Franklin, Al Di Meola, Aerosmith, Al Green, Alanis Morissette, A Perfect Circle, and more. Then settle in for an unforgettable Grateful Dead concert featuring rare setlist surprises, classic jams, and George's signature storytelling.It's four hours of musical therapy, deep cuts, live recordings, and the wonderfully unpredictable journey that has made Lyons Den a KUNV tradition for 28 years.

    The Lyons Den: John Coltrane, Miles Davis, Weather Report & Derek and the Dominos Live at Fillmore East

    George Lyons takes listeners on an unforgettable musical journey through the evolution of jazz, fusion, and classic rock on this edition of The Lyons Den on 91.5 KUNV Las Vegas. The evening features legendary artists including John Coltrane, Donald Byrd, John McLaughlin, John Klemmer, Mike Stern, Miles Davis, Weather Report, Return to Forever, and more, exploring the groundbreaking sounds that transformed modern music. The show concludes with a spectacular live concert presentation from Derek and the Dominos, recorded at the legendary Fillmore East in October 1970, featuring Eric Clapton and one of the most celebrated performances in rock history.     Lyons Den with George Lyons | Progressive Rock, Rare Grooves & The Who Live in Las Vegas 2006 | KUNV 91.5

    Enter the Lyons Den with George Lyons on KUNV 91.5 Las Vegas—an iconic freeform radio experience blending progressive rock, psychedelic classics, reggae, soul, funk, and legendary live music. In this unforgettable episode, George Lyons curates an adventurous sonic journey featuring Marvin Gaye, Massive Attack, Pink Floyd, Porcupine Tree, Radiohead, Prince, Portishead, Rare Earth, reggae essentials, and more before delivering a monumental live broadcast of The Who from Mandalay Bay Events Center in Las Vegas on November 10, 2006. Hear explosive performances of “Baba O’Riley,” “Behind Blue Eyes,” “Won’t Get Fooled Again,” “Pinball Wizard,” and other rock essentials in a show that captures the spirit of deep music discovery and authentic radio craftsmanship.     The Lyons Den | George Lyons Spring 1990 Grateful Dead Special + Bob Dylan, Frank Zappa & Deep Musical Journeys

    This week on The Lyons Den, George Lyons delivers a four-hour sonic odyssey through genre, generation, and musical transcendence—blending Frank Zappa, Bob Marley, Bob Dylan, acid jazz, electronic grooves, and a full legendary Grateful Dead concert from March 30, 1990, recorded live at Nassau Veterans Memorial Coliseum during Brent Mydland’s final spring tour.From “Three Little Birds” and Visions of Johanna to an immersive Spring 1990 Grateful Dead box set experience featuring Help on the Way, Franklin’s Tower, Terrapin Station, Standing on the Moon, and more, George crafts a listener-supported journey through what he calls the “church of music.” This episode is a masterclass in curation, storytelling, and deep musical appreciation—celebrating timeless artistry, live performance, and the transformative power of sound.
